good start of a list so far. the predator is a hand held programmer. chips dont exists on these cars. you reprogram the ECU in most all cars 1996-2012+ ;)

Intakes....basically pick which ever you think looks pretty and run with it. theres not much difference between whats on the market. with exhaust, depending on where you live, stainless may be more advantageous than regular. obviously salted and snowy areas, stainless would have the advantage. best advice, get something made for your car. not just something off another car that was restrictive there and will be restrictive on yours. theres plenty of options out there from a rear end section kit from blastin bobs to a full cat back from zoomers, magnaflow, flowmaster, etc... personally i'd go with a kit. theres alot of exhaust places that will do a total hack job, so unless the place locally is credible, a kit will give you smooth mandrel bent exhaust, not exhaust with clamped and crimped pipes that flow worse than stock. mandrel bent pipes have their advantages by far. it took me a while to learn that lesson. ;)
